Both companies have requested the FDA add semaglutide and tirzepatide, respectively, to its lists of drug products that present demonstrable difficulties for compounding. These DDC Lists identify substances that are considered particularly risky to compound, and drugs on these lists cannot be compounded under either 503A or 503B which could be the biggest problem for companies like Hims
